  • 5/5 Reginald W. 4 years ago on Google
    Having visited here two times, now, I can attest to the quality of the hamburgers, their noodle dishes and their breakfasts. All represent very good value, are attractively presented and served by a pleasingly upbeat staff. Indeed, the staff here—most of whom are handicapped in one way or another—seem to have very happy hearts, made possible no doubt by the owner, Thao. She, handicapped herself, is dedicated to providing employment and opportunity for others who face similar obstacles. The new venu sparkles with fresh white walls, lots of light, pleasant decor and comfortable seating. It’s easy to see why she has so many regular customers.

  • 5/5 Joana D. 5 years ago on Google
    Featuring the English breakfast, it’s honestly an all time win. For the price of 125K you get this (your choice of how you want your eggs), and coffee/tea of your choice. The place is great - aircon, a lot of space, comfortable seating options inside or outside, possibility to charge electronics... now what you might want to know is that most of the staff is deaf and mute, but the service is amazing nonetheless. Just don’t forget to point at what you want, and don’t shout after them if you need something, you’ll be wasting energy more than anything else... came back later that day for dinner, and the chicken salad, quesadillas, meat lover pizza and fish and chips are to die for - honestly, come in, even if it’s just to grab a drink. Ah, they also use bamboo straws, so kudos to that 😉
